Where Business Class is designed with the business traveller in mind, First Class is designed to be the ultimate experience in the sky. As a result, the biggest differences come down to space, service, privacy and of course price. Service in particular is hugely different in First Class. Find out what is "real" first class and how to distinguish it from business class. First Class is typically 50%-100% more expensive than flying in Business Class. Expect to pay up to double the price to fly in First Class. As an example, London to Singapore return in Business Class costs around £4,500 – £5,000 GBP, and the same route in First costs around £8,000 to £9,000 GBP.

Some transcontinental flights, however, may have business-class lie-flat seats, but this varies based on the airline ...Cost of Premium Economy vs. Business Class. On average, Premium Economy costs 30% more than Economy class. But, the exact cost of Premium Economy depends on the airline and market demand. Business class tickets cost between three to four times what Economy class tickets cost.
